What are the main responsibilities and challenges faced by an Assistant Retreat Coordinator during the planning and execution of a retreat?

As an Assistant Retreat Coordinator, you’ll be involved in a variety of tasks such as managing logistics, communicating with vendors, organizing schedules, and ensuring attendees’ needs are met. A common challenge is adapting to last-minute changes, such as unexpected weather or schedule adjustments, which requires flexibility and problem-solving skills. You’ll typically work closely with a small team, collaborating with facilitators, caterers, and venue staff to ensure the retreat runs smoothly. This role offers a dynamic environment where strong organizational and interpersonal skills are essential for success and can provide valuable experience for advancement into event management or program leadership positions.

What is an Assistant Retreat?

An Assistant Retreat is a structured event or gathering designed specifically for assistants, such as executive assistants, administrative assistants, or office support staff. The goal of these retreats is to provide professional development, team-building opportunities, and skills training in a focused and supportive environment. Participants often engage in workshops, networking activities, and sessions on topics like time management, communication, and leadership. These retreats help assistants recharge, gain new knowledge, and connect with peers, ultimately enhancing their effectiveness at work.

Executive Assistant (Personal & Business Assistant)

About the role We are looking for a sharp, dependable right hand to help run the business side of two growing organizations — Healthcare offices in (Laurelhurst & Magnolia) and a mobile clinic — plus a personal wellness retreat project on the side located in Woodinville. This is a hybrid role: equal parts behind-the-scenes operator and in-person team energizer.

What you'll do

  • Handle monthly bill pay and payroll across both businesses
  • Manage and update wellness retreat website, plus its related bills/subscriptions
  • Coordinate and help run meetings with corporate partners
  • Visit the offices 1–2x/week — bring snacks, bring good energy, be a friendly presence for the team
  • Check in regularly with doctors and dental assistants to make sure nothing's falling through the cracks
  • General admin support as things come up

What we're looking for

  • Organized, proactive, and comfortable juggling finance tasks and people tasks in the same week
  • Basic comfort with bookkeeping/payroll tools and simple website edits (Squarespace/Wix-type platforms)
  • Warm, outgoing — someone who genuinely likes walking into a room and lifting the mood
  • Trustworthy with financial and confidential information
  • Reliable transportation for office visits
  • Background check

Good to have

  • Experience in a small business or healthcare office setting, Google sheets and drive
  • Familiarity with QuickBooks or similar payroll/accounting software

Logistics

  • Part-time / flexible, with set weekly hours for finance tasks + 1–2 in-office visits
  • Seattle area (Laurelhurst & Magnolia offices) and Woodinville Retreat center
